diff options
author | bnicholes <bnicholes@13f79535-47bb-0310-9956-ffa450edef68> | 2008-04-09 22:40:14 +0000 |
---|---|---|
committer | bnicholes <bnicholes@13f79535-47bb-0310-9956-ffa450edef68> | 2008-04-09 22:40:14 +0000 |
commit | 47aae94dd3f4a8233ca5b2322341e8b8150ef355 (patch) | |
tree | 1a4992aaa693607ce5fdcfae3df414bba0553d07 | |
parent | b8074515f748e43e09806f884e9fd52556359cea (diff) | |
download | libapr-47aae94dd3f4a8233ca5b2322341e8b8150ef355.tar.gz |
Initialize the rebind functionality early within the APR library itself to avoid application unload issues. This ties apr to apr-util however on NetWare both libraries are combined.
git-svn-id: http://svn.apache.org/repos/asf/apr/apr/trunk@646580 13f79535-47bb-0310-9956-ffa450edef68
-rw-r--r-- | misc/netware/start.c |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/misc/netware/start.c b/misc/netware/start.c index c8ccc1c1c..1e5708d1f 100644 --- a/misc/netware/start.c +++ b/misc/netware/start.c @@ -38,6 +38,7 @@ int (*WSAStartupWithNLMHandle)( WORD version, LPWSADATA data, void *handle ) = NULL; int (*WSACleanupWithNLMHandle)( void *handle ) = NULL; +apr_status_t apr_ldap_rebind_init(apr_pool_t *pool); static int wsa_startup_with_handle (WORD wVersionRequested, LPWSADATA data, void *handle) { @@ -151,6 +152,7 @@ APR_DECLARE(apr_status_t) apr_initialize(void) #endif apr_signal_init(pool); + apr_ldap_rebind_init(pool); return APR_SUCCESS; } |